Stopped playing this about 2 weeks after I got it, just too repetitive. Real shame because the graphics are brilliant and there's so much potential. Storyline etc felt very rushed and outside of missions there's not much to do bar whipping muscle cars about. Think games like GTA set the bar with all the stuff you can do outside main missions, and that's where mafia III fell short imo.
